- The courses and either of them will be closed after consultation between The Manager and the Course Superintendent
- Decisions to alter the style of play (including preferred lies, tee up, banning buggies, etc.) will be made after a meeting between the Course Superintendent and The Manager
- Lady Members will always be bound by Course decisions in respect to playing conditions, however, when preferred lies apply they may approve tee up but they cannot reduce a condition e.g. change tee up back to preferred lies or approve buggies if a ban exists
- The WGV requires a formal notice of any position change of Ladies' tee markers exceeding nine metres from official WGV markers
- The Gold tees will be used by Men and the Green tees will be used by Ladies for:
- (a) all monthly medals
- (b) all rounds of Club Championships (including Junior Championship)
- (c) all rounds of Foursomes Championship
- (d) all rounds of Mixed Foursomes Championship
- (e) semi final/final rounds of Captains Trophy
- Flag colours as follows will be used to identify the pin placements:
- (a) Red - back
- (b) Yellow - centre
- (c) Blue - front
- The houses which abound the course are private property. No entry is permitted beyond the out of bounds stakes
- All ground beyond the Club's boundary fence and areas marked by white stakes with black tops, are out of bounds
- When playing the St John 2nd hole, the fairway and rough of the 4th hole is out of bounds
- When playing the St John 11th hole, the area above and to the left of the cliff face is out of bounds
- When playing the St John 9th hole, the fairway and rough of the 8th hole is out of bounds
